Two simultaneously existing giant effects – strain sensing and gas sensing – were found and investigated in polyisoprene–carbon nano-composites.
Sensitivity to any kind of deformation was found depending on the time of vulcanization. High-structure carbon nano-particle filler was chosen as
guaranty of manifestation of polyisoprene composites as multifunctional sensors with high reversibility and rapidity of sensing effects.
